• OpenAPI 简介
  • 小程序 OpenAPI SDK 总览
  • 签名算法
  • 基础能力
  • 触达与营销
  • 搜索能力
  • 订阅消息
  • 挂载
  • 分发
  • 私信和群聊
  • 群聊管理
  • 粉丝群管理
  • 查询群信息
  • 创建粉丝群
  • 查询用户剩余建群额度
  • 变更用户入群申请状态
  • 查询群主所在群的用户入群申请状态
  • 粉丝群webhook
  • 设置进群问候语&群公告
  • 取消进群问候语&群公告配置
  • 群消息管理
  • 经营工具
  • 私信管理
  • 私域经营常见问题
  • 支付
  • 运营
  • 生活服务
  • 垂直行业
  • 其它
  • 设置进群问候语&群公告

    收藏
    我的收藏

    使用限制

      需要用户授权,授权用户需为粉丝群群主身份
      仅支持粉丝群类型的群聊

    接口说明

    本接口可用于设置进群问候语,群公告配置。

    基本信息

    名称
    描述
    HTTP URL
    https://open.douyin.com/im/group/setting/set/
    HTTP Method
    POST
    Scope
    im.group_fans.create_list

    请求头

    名称
    字段类型
    是否必填
    示例
    描述
    access-token
    String
    bus_act.1d1021d2aee3d41fee2d2adfwdf56badMFZnrhFhfWotu3Ecuiuka27L56lr
    通过 BusinessToken 进行调用
    content-type
    String
    application/json
    固定值"application/json"

    请求参数

    Query

    名称
    字段类型
    是否必填
    示例
    描述
    open_id
    String
    ba253642-0590-40bc-9bdf-9a1334b94059
    可以通过 code2Session 接口获取,用户唯一标志

    Body

    名称
    字段类型
    是否必填
    示例
    描述
    group_id
    String
    粉丝群 ID
    group_setting_type
    Enum
    群管理配置类型
    WELCOME=1
    欢迎语
    NOTICE=2
    群公告
    msg_list
    List
    欢迎语支持
      同时设置文本 + 小程序引导卡片
      同时设置文本 + 小程序券
    群公告只支持设置文本
    msg_type
    msg_type
    Enum
    回复内容的类型
    TEXT=1
    APPLETCARD=10
    APPLET_COUPON=11
    applet_coupon
    Struct
    小程序券
    activity_id
    Int64
    activity_id 获取方式详见 查询授权用户发放的活动信息
    coupon_meta_id
    Int64
    coupon_id 获取方式详见 查询券模板
    text
    Struct
    文字内容
    text
    String
    文字内容,长度需小于 150
    applet_card
    card_template_id
    String
    卡片模板 ID
    path
    String
    api/apiPage/apiPage
    通过URL Link进入的小程序页面路径,必须是已经发布的小程序存在的页面,不可携带 query。path 为空时会跳转小程序主页。
    query
    String
    {\"key1\":\"val1\",\"key2\":\"val2\"}
    通过URL Link进入小程序时的 query(json形式),若无请填{}。最大1024个字符,只支持数字,大小写英文以及部分特殊字符:{}!#$&'()*+,/:;=?@-._~%`。
    app_id
    String
    小程序

    请求示例

    curl -X POST 'https://open.douyin.com//im/group/setting/set/?open_id=_000xzRQpcoxD3BxBa8gh_pSqhCts9e7W5Of' \ -H 'Content-Type:application/json' \ -H 'access-token:act.3.twcMj968gNlk10bQxejCFptAgy7xz14cpuNplMTCt4PKnO8_K2pzgTfWh6PuCI9iBuUBrMxmc357OI_9zz-BP2ypsGC1giKiQEyzWiRSc48Vk_mh3Q_yJJjKInJslCnbzUPBP7k3LHM-mw-4M2yDwbQNROIvpQOs8o_DK96ZnEUj9xfXqQk1oZy_I48=' \ \ --data ' { "group_setting_type":1, "group_id":"@4F8C16DLBMpoayH0MI44GaX+1WSGOvqKMpZ2rgigLVAab/b033bhf2Iujgn96zUFzrEMFkG/vUKhYHQ90PrjsQ==", \ "msg_list":[ { "msg_type":1, "text":{ \ "text":"66666" } }, { "msg_type":10, \ "applet_card":{ "card_template_id":"@4F8C16DLB+1WSGO/yAA61JkTKeF2ltKgvvhATKtvrScVZhhxZ/", \ "schema":"https://z.douyin.com/lktwYRo", "app_id":"ttfa398c06e94401" \ } } ] }' \

    响应参数

    Body

    名称
    字段类型
    是否必填
    示例
    描述
    err_msg
    String
    err_no
    Int32
    log_id
    String

    响应示例

    正常示例

    { "err_msg": "", "err_no": 0, "log_id": "02169835144317200000000000000000000ffff0a707803a3982e" }

    异常示例

    { "err_no": 28001007, "err_msg": "invalid text, contains url pattern", "log_id": "202405202301116F2D6D2E84AC0F262D2C" }

    错误码

    HTTP 状态码
    错误码
    错误码描述
    排查建议
    200
    28001005
    系统内部错误,请重试
    请求重试,若依然无解请向平台提交反馈
    200
    28001003
    access_token无效
    重新请求生成access_token
    200
    28001008
    access_token过期,请刷新或重新授权
    重新请求生成access_token
    200
    28001016
    当前应用已被封禁或下线
    clientKey被封禁或者下线
    200
    28001006
    网络调用错误,请重试
    重试即可
    200
    28001014
    应用未授权任何能力
    确认应用是否授权能力
    200
    28001018
    应用未获得该能力
    开通相关能力
    200
    28003017
    quota已用完
    联系平台处理
    200
    28001019
    应用该能力已被封禁
    该能力被封禁,联系平台处理
    200
    28001007
    参数不合法
    根据错误信息检查请求参数是否填写正常